Women’s Shed Arcadia

At the July womens shed gathering in Arcadia, Diana a skilled, local artist demonstrated how to make a bead and flower using colored felt and silk. Everyone enjoyed the hands-on, creative project and morning tea. The women’s shed is held in Arcadia the third Thursday of the month from 10am to 12noon. Contact Suzanne on […]

Applications Encouraged for Hills Community Grants Program

Community groups, organisation and not-forprofits are being encouraged to apply for the latest round of Hills Community Grants. The annual program, which opens on August 1 to applicants, provides funding between $1000 and $15,000 to projects which fall within four main priority areas, including: Events that connect the community; Domestic violence prevention and recovery; Mental […]
Funding Needed For Blackspots and Safer Roads

The State and Federal Governments are being called upon to fund 6 major road projects across the Hills in a bid to help reduce the number of accidents in the area. Hills Shire Council is pushing for $2 million to go towards safety upgrades on Annangrove Road, including installing flexible barriers, adding vehicle-activated advanced warning […]
